> In the SR disable path it is recommended to wait
> for Voltage processor to idle before disabling the
> VP.

>  static void sr_disable(struct omap_sr *sr)
>  {
> +     u32 i = 0;
> +
>       sr->is_sr_reset = 1;
>  
>       /* SRCONFIG - disable SR */
>       sr_modify_reg(sr, SRCONFIG, SRCONFIG_SRENABLE, ~SRCONFIG_SRENABLE);
>  
>       if (sr->srid == SR1) {
> +             /* Wait for VP idle before disabling VP */
> +             while ((!prm_read_mod_reg(OMAP3430_GR_MOD,
> +                                     OMAP3_PRM_VP1_STATUS_OFFSET))
> +                                     && i++ < MAX_TRIES)
> +                     udelay(1);
> +
> +             if (i >= MAX_TRIES)
> +                     pr_warning("VP1 not idle, still going ahead with \
> +                                                     VP1 disable\n");
> +
>               /* Disable VP1 */
>               prm_clear_mod_reg_bits(PRM_VP1_CONFIG_VPENABLE, OMAP3430_GR_MOD,
>                                       OMAP3_PRM_VP1_CONFIG_OFFSET);
> +
>       } else if (sr->srid == SR2) {
> +             /* Wait for VP idle before disabling VP */
> +             while ((!prm_read_mod_reg(OMAP3430_GR_MOD,
> +                                     OMAP3_PRM_VP2_STATUS_OFFSET))
> +                                     && i++ < MAX_TRIES)
> +                     udelay(1);
> +
> +             if (i >= MAX_TRIES)
> +                     pr_warning("VP2 not idle, still going ahead with \
> +                                                      VP2 disable\n");
> +
>               /* Disable VP2 */
>               prm_clear_mod_reg_bits(PRM_VP2_CONFIG_VPENABLE, OMAP3430_GR_MOD,
>                                       OMAP3_PRM_VP2_CONFIG_OFFSET);
